David Wallin

David Wallin — born in Sweden in 1976 — is HammerFall's drummer across two periods: between 2014 and 2016 and again since 2017. He came in replacing Anders Johansson, who had held the role for fifteen years and came from a very different technical school — that of Yngwie Malmsteen's neoclassical metal. Taking over after a drummer with that résumé, in a repertoire demanding steadiness more than virtuosity, is a position of particular exposure. His function is defined by HammerFall's format. The band plays traditional heavy metal designed to work live with the audience singing along: firm tempos, clear marking, choruses that thousands of people have to follow at once. The drums hold that without variation that would confuse — deliberate simplicity executed with absolute precision. He recorded Built to Last (2016), Dominion (2019), Hammer of Dawn (2022) and Avenge the Fallen (2024), forming with Fredrik Larsson the rhythm section of the current line-up, alongside Oscar Dronjak, Joacim Cans and Pontus Norgren.
